Basketball Recap: Fayette Falcons vs. Linn Wildcats
Fayette had lost 13 straight headed into Friday's contest, but Kaleb Friebe didn't let it get to 14. The Fayette Falcons secured a 50-46 W over the Linn Wildcats on Friday thanks in part to Friebe, who dropped a double-double on 23 points and ten rebounds. The game was his third in a row with at least ten points.
Colten Cross was another key player, almost dropping a double-double on nine points and ten boards. He is trending in the right direction considering he's improved his point production for four straight games.
When it comes to explaining why Linn lost, don't look at Gus Peters. Despite the final result, he went 9 for 18 on his way to 22 points and three steals. Those 22 points gave Peters a new career-high.

Fayette's victory ended a 15-game drought on the road dating back to last season and puts them at 1-12. As for Linn, they are on a four-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 1-15.
Fayette did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 79-21 loss against Blair Oaks on the 28th. As for Linn, they also w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next contest, a 79-31 defeat against Hallsville on the 28th.
